Fall lawn care services typically involve preparing lawns for the colder months ahead. This includes tasks such as aerating the soil to improve nutrient and water absorption, overseeding to promote thick, healthy grass growth, and applying fertilization tailored for fall conditions. These services help ensure that lawns remain healthy and resilient throughout the winter, minimizing damage caused by seasonal stressors. Proper fall preparation can also support vigorous growth in the following spring, leading to a lush and vibrant yard.

One of the primary problems that fall lawn care services address is the buildup of thatch and debris, which can hinder grass growth and promote disease. Removing leaves, sticks, and other organic matter helps improve airflow and reduces the risk of fungal infections. Additionally, fall fertilization provides essential nutrients that support root development and overall lawn health during dormancy. These services can also include pest management to prevent overwintering insects from causing damage when the growing season resumes.

The overview below groups typical Fall Lawn Care proj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Grove City,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Lawn Mowing - The cost for fall lawn mowing typically ranges from $30 to $60 per visit, depending on the size of the yard and the complexity of the terrain. Larger properties or those requiring extra services may see higher rates.

Aeration and Overseeding - Services like aeration and overseeding generally cost between $100 and $300, with prices influenced by lawn size and soil condition. These treatments help promote healthy grass growth during the fall season.

Leaf Removal - Professional leaf removal services usually range from $50 to $150, based on the amount of foliage and yard size. Some providers charge per hour, which can vary from $40 to $80 per hour.

Fertilization - Fall fertilization services tend to cost between $70 and $200, depending on the type of fertilizer used and lawn size. Proper fertilization supports grass health heading into winter months.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When is the best time to overseed my lawn in fall? Local lawn care providers recommend overseeding in early to mid-fall to promote healthy grass growth before winter.

How often should I mow my lawn during fall? Mowing frequency can vary, but generally, grass should be cut regularly to keep it at an appropriate height as the season progresses.

Should I fertilize my lawn in the fall? Many service providers suggest fall fertilization to strengthen grass roots and improve winter resilience.

What fall lawn cleanup services are available? Providers often offer leaf removal, debris clearing, and lawn edging to prepare the yard for winter.

How can I prevent weeds from taking over in fall? Local pros may recommend targeted weed control treatments and proper lawn maintenance to reduce weed growth during this season.
